Creating a seamless and reliable spin session in an online casino environment requires a careful blend of technical precision, user-centric design, and consistent system performance. At the core of such a session is the architecture of the platform, which must prioritize stability, responsiveness, and predictable output patterns. The layout of the spin interface plays a crucial role in this experience. Users need a visually clear and intuitively organized space where controls, information displays, and game elements are positioned logically, allowing effortless interaction and minimizing cognitive load. Buttons for initiating spins, adjusting bets, and viewing paytables should be clearly distinguishable and grouped according to function, promoting a fluid interaction flow that feels natural and uninterrupted.
Behind the visual interface, the session’s consistency depends heavily on the underlying system logic. Each spin should be executed with reliable algorithms that generate outcomes swiftly while adhering to fairness protocols. This requires a robust random number generation system, coupled with precise input handling to ensure that user commands are accurately captured and executed without delay. A system that can process high-frequency interactions while maintaining stable performance is essential for sustaining user confidence and engagement. Any perceptible lag, erratic behavior, or inconsistency in spin outcomes can disrupt the experience, making reliability a non-negotiable aspect of session design.

The throughput flow—the rate at which spins are processed and results displayed—must remain steady under varying loads. Efficient server architecture, load balancing, and optimized communication protocols between client interfaces and backend systems ensure that each spin is resolved quickly, regardless of concurrent user activity. Monitoring tools can track system health in real time, preemptively detecting anomalies or bottlenecks before they impact the player. This proactive approach safeguards the session against interruptions and preserves a continuous, immersive experience. For the user, the perception of consistency is reinforced by uniform response times, smooth animations, and predictable sequences, all of which contribute to the feeling of a well-engineered system.
Equally important is the management of session continuity. Users expect to move seamlessly between spins, rounds, or bonus features without experiencing disjointed transitions. Systems should maintain state awareness, ensuring that balance updates, feature triggers, and win tallies persist accurately throughout the session. Notifications and feedback should be immediate and contextually relevant, signaling outcomes without unnecessary delay or ambiguity. Another layer of reliability is risk management and error handling. The system should anticipate and gracefully handle unexpected events, such as network interruptions, rapid input sequences, or server strain. Automatic reconnection protocols, rollback mechanisms, and clear messaging prevent these disruptions from impacting user experience. By mitigating potential failure points and providing transparent recovery paths, the platform maintains the integrity of each session, ensuring that gameplay remains uninterrupted and outcomes are fair.
